There is a device/bit of kit, which was advertised in several up-market independents. Dension. It is a bit of behind the dash kit, that utilises an unused auxiliary channel if fitted. It may be worth looking into this.
Find out what system you have in the car. Then visit a dealer, or the website. It seemed like a good piece of kit, but it's not necessarily a cheap option. The other option is to bin the current kit, and buy an all singing, all dancing head unit from Kenwood/Alpine/Sony.

Do you want to use your phone as a phone or music? If you want music and your headunit has front or rear aux/USB then you can get a lead. You can get a lead from connects2 that will do it or a unit that tunes into 88.1 fm and plays that way also charging your phone at the same time. If you want it to do as a phone get a Parrot. |
